Get Directions to National B2B Centre
International Manufacturing Centre, Warwick University, Coventry, Warwickshire CV4 7AL, United Kingdom, Coventry, England
International Manufacturing Centre, Warwick University, Coventry, Warwickshire CV4 7AL, United Kingdom, Coventry, England